databases='test1 test2' Date=$(date "+%Y-%m-%d") Time=$(date "+%H%M%S") for db in $databases do mkdir -p `echo /home/backup/mysql/$db/$Date` done for db in $databases do tables=`mysql -u root -p123456 $db -e "show t
体验简介 本场景将提供一台阿里云MongoDB数据库。 完成本教程操作后,您可以使用数据管理服务DMS(Data Management Service)连接到MongoDB实例,然后进行数据表的CRUD操作(即对数据表执行增加(Create)、检索(Retrieve)、更新(Update)和删除(Delete)操作。)。 体验此场景后,可以掌握的知识有: ● DMS
作用 database links 是数据库之间的通路,建立连接后通过select * from tbname@linkname;可以访问远程数据库。 如何创建? create database link db_1 connect to db_2_user identified by "db_2_user_password" using 'DEMO = (DESCRIPTION = (ADDRESS_LIST =
mongodb常用基本操作 mongodb 默认存在的库 test:登录时,默认连接存在的库 管理MongoDB有关的系统库 > db #查看当前所在哪个库 test > show collections; show tables; > > show databases; show dbs admin 0.000GB config 0.000GB local 0.000GB > admin库:系统预留库,Mo
假如hive中table或者partition的location错误或者丢失,需要批量修复,可以参考如下步骤: 修复table的location hdfs dfs -ls /data/hive/warehouse/$db | awk '{print $8}' |sed '1d' | awk -F '/' '{print "alter table "$5"."$7" set locati
python连接Oracle数据库 查看Oracle版本 select * from v$version 下载对应版本的InstantClient 下载网址 InstantClient 1.解压InstantClient 2.环境变量 3.将其解压目录下的oci.dll、oraocieixx.dll、oraoccixx.dll文件复制到python安装目录的Lib/site-packages文件夹下 安
MySQL分库分表备份 脚本内容如下 #!/bin/bash DATE=$(date +%F_%H-%M-%S) HOST=192.168.0.123 USER=root PASS=数据库密码 BACKUP_DIR=/data/db_backup #分库备份 DB_LIST=$(mysql -h$HOST -u$USER -p$PASS -s -e "show databases;" 2>/dev/null |egrep -v "Database|informatio
django内置信号 一 信号简介 Django提供一种信号机制。其实就是观察者模式,又叫发布-订阅(Publish/Subscribe) 。当发生一些动作的时候,发出信号,然后监听了这个信号的函数就会执行。 通俗来讲,就是一些动作发生的时候,信号允许特定的发送者去提醒一些接受者。用于在框架执行操作时解
一、配置文件注解 1、@Configuration 配置类的注解。在META-INF\spring.factories中声明是配置类 文件内容如下: org.springframework.boot.autoconfigure.EnableAutoConfiguration=\ com.unit.db.starter.DataSourceAutoConfiguration,\ com.unit.db.starter.DruidProp
package main import ( "fmt" _ "github.com/jinzhu/gorm/dialects/mysql" "github.com/jinzhu/gorm" "time") var ( //变量db 通过init直接初始化 db *gorm.DB err error dbinfo string) const ( //定义db的连接信息 dbuser string = "root&qu
服务器demo 测试路由 浏览器url输入不能测试POST请求!!!看清楚是get请求再测 login:1 GET http://127.0.0.1:8080/douyin/user/login 404 (Not Found) 修改完代码要马上重启服务 这是一个结构体(go里省略分号),Response(这也是结构体,里面有StatusCode,StatusMsg),一部分是自定义数据
1. 管理查看语句show dbsshow collections;show users;use db获取当前库名db.getName()当前数据库状态db.stats()查看当前版本db.version() 1.1 创建用户use bg_base db.createUser({user:"devtymongo",pwd:"#############",roles:[{role:"readWrite",db:"bg_base"
docker-compose搭建nextcloud 前置条件 安装docker docker-compose配置文件 version: '3.5' services: db_nextcloud: container_name: db_nextcloud image: mariadb command: --transaction-isolation=READ-COMMITTED --binlog-format=ROW networks:
示例代码: clear all close all clc %% help % 线型: -(实线) 标记符:+(加号符) 颜色:r(红色)。 % 线型: :(点线) 标记符:o(空心小圆圈) 颜色:g(绿色)。 % 线型: -.(点划线) 标记符:*(星号) 颜色:b(蓝色)。 % 线型: --(虚线) 标记符:.(点) 颜色:c(青绿色)。 % 线型: --(虚线) 标记符:x(叉号)
一 ORM框架介绍和选择 1.1 ORM介绍和选择 ORM是“对象-关系-映射”的简称,Go语言中常用的ORM框架如下 gorm 老牌国产Golang orm框架。支持主流关系型数据库。中文文档适合新人入手,国内使用较多。最新版本2.x,比1.x有较大改动 注意:Gorm最新地址为https://github.com/go-gorm/gorm,之
#include <bits/stdc++.h> #define fre(x) freopen( #x ".in", "r", stdin ), freopen( #x ".out", "w", stdout ) using namespace std; typedef long long ll; typedef unsigned long long ull; typedef __float128 db; cons
效果: docker-compose version: "3" networks: gitea: external: false services: server: image: gitea/gitea:latest container_name: gitea environment: - USER_UID=1000 - USER_GID=1000 - DB_TYPE=mysql - DB_
与更新现有集合字段相同,$set如果指定的字段不存在,将添加新的字段。 看看这个例子: > db.foo.find() > db.foo.insert({"test":"a"}) > db.foo.find() { "_id" : ObjectId("4e93037bbf6f1dd3a0a9541a"), "test" : "a" } > item = db.fo
1、Read/Write Through方案 读取:先取缓存数据,如果命中直接返回;如果未命中,穿透到DB读取,再更新缓存,并返回 写入:先更新db, 尝试更新缓存;如果缓存服务有问题,直接返回;如果缓存正常,正常更新缓存 问题1:线程A穿透读DB版本V1, 准备更新缓存
常用的模块 模块 功能 asm 汇编与反汇编 dynelf 远程符号泄漏 elf 对elf文件进行操作 memleak 用于内存泄漏 shellcraft shellcode生成器 gdb 配合gdb调试 utils 一些实用的小功能 结合CTF例题 题目1 下载附件pwn1,使用checksec检查保护 $ checksec pwn1
因为项目需求,需要去项目的Oracle数据库定时获取部分数据,在本地Windows环境配置连接Oracle的方法,一边百度,一边操作,碰到一个问题卡了一天,在这里记录分享下处理方法,希望对大家有所帮助。 1. 安装Oracle Instant Client 从oracle官方网站下载instant client文件,链接:https:/
目录一:flask-sqlalchemy操作1.引入:2.Flask-Migrate扩展3.flask-sqlalchemy与slask_migrate作用4.flask-migrate初始化与迁移数据库介绍5.flask-sqlalchemy 操作迁移数据库6.导出项目依赖二:Flask-Migrate的作用负责表结构同步(一) 安装插件(二)使用1、实例化2、添加命令(三) 同步表结
单表操作 增 @app.route("/add_book") def add_book(): ro1 = Books(name='三国演义')#增加Books中name为三国演义的数据 db.session.add(ro1)#增加 db.session.commit()#提交 return "添加成功" 删 @app.route("/del_book") def del_book():
【深入理解TcaplusDB技术】 Tmonitor单机安装操作介绍 本节分别介绍Tmonitor web portal和后台进程的安装部署,web portal和后台最好能分别安装在不同的机器上。注意:所有操作均在root权限下执行。 安装需要3个包(以安装时最新的发布包为准): web_portal_2.2.18_05130ad9.tar.gz 主
一 系统简介 1.简介 该系统可以实时显示噪声量大小,并进行一段时间的噪声统计。 2.特性 实现噪声值的统计 实现了噪声显示 完整的主题和样式控制 多线程的运行模式 二 源码解析 1.串口db值获取: def uart_recv_header(serial): cnt=0 while True: